select a.index_name, a.table_name, b.column_name, b.column_position
from user_indexes a, user_ind_columns b
where a.index_name = b.index_name;
select * from employees
where email like 'SK%'
create index idx_fullname
on employees (first_name, last_name)
select first_name, last_name
from employees
where first_name like '%'
and last_name like '%'
select first_name, last_name
from employees
where first_name like 'Ellen'
and last_name like 'Abel'
//시퀀스
create table board (
no number primary key,
title varchar2(20),
contents varchar2(50) )
drop sequence board_seq
create sequence board_seq
start with 1
increment by 1
insert into board
values (board_seq.nextval, '알림', '월요일 반드시 출근')
select * from board
select board_seq.nextval from dual
select board_seq.currval from dual
'Computer > DB' 카테고리의 다른 글
SQL cursor (0) | 2014.09.01 |
---|---|
SQL 제약조건 (0) | 2014.09.01 |
SQL if (0) | 2014.09.01 |
SQL 문자 관련함수 (0) | 2014.09.01 |
SQL nvl union rollup cube (0) | 2014.09.01 |